BANNERS: Global HANDWASHING Day | October 15 (#GlobalHandWashingDay)

Global Handwashing Day (GHD) is a campaign to motivate and mobilize people around the world to improve their handwashing habits. Washing hands at critical points during the day and washing with soap are both important. #GlobalHandwashingDay

Global Handwashing Day occurs on 15 October of each year. The global campaign is dedicated to raising awareness of handwashing with soap as a key factor in disease prevention. Respiratory and intestinal diseases can be reduced by 25-50%.




The Global Handwashing Partnership (GHP) (formerly called "Public Private Partnership for Handwashing" (PPPHW)) established Global Handwashing Day in 2008 as a way to promote a global and local vision of handwashing with soap.

BANNERS: National MUSHROOM Day | October 15 (#NationalMushroomDay)

Whether it's a cremini, portobello, enoki, shiitake or otherwise, this nutritious fungus definitely deserves a day of its own. Though neither meat nor vegetable, mushrooms are known as the "meat" of the vegetable world. #NationalMushroomDay

Celebrate this unofficial holiday today by serving up some mushrooms in an omelette, in a soup, in a salad, as a side dish - or any way you like!
